What would it mean to reconnect?

We believe that we were created for relationships…like good relationships — with God, one another, ourselves and the rest of creation. But that’s easier said than done, right?

We get hurt. Or we do some of the hurting. We feel fractured, broken and bent.

So what would it look like to reconnect and experience life the way we were meant to: whole, vulnerable, loved and well, connected? We want to help you get there.

Let’s find a way to reconnect.
